Description
Indulge in the delightful combination of sugar cookies and fudge with this easy-to-make recipe for Sugar Cookie Fudge. Creamy white chocolate, sweetened condensed milk, and a hint of vanilla create a luscious base, while sugar cookie mix adds a nostalgic twist. Finish with rainbow sprinkles for a festive touch!
Ingredients
Scale
For the Fudge:
- 2 cups white chocolate chips
- 1 cup sweetened condensed milk
- 1/2 cup sugar cookie mix (dry)
- 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
- Pinch of salt
- 2 tablespoons rainbow sprinkles (optional)
For Topping:
- Extra sprinkles for topping
Instructions
- Prepare the Fudge: Line an 8×8-inch baking dish with parchment paper. Melt white chocolate chips and sweetened condensed milk in a saucepan. Stir in sugar cookie mix, vanilla extract, and salt until smooth. Fold in sprinkles.
- Set the Fudge: Pour the mixture into the dish, smooth the top, and add more sprinkles. Chill for at least 2 hours.
- Serve: Lift the fudge out using the parchment, cut into squares, and enjoy!
Notes
- Feel free to use any type of sugar cookie mix for this recipe.
- The fudge can be stored in the fridge for up to a week.
